How much does it cost to rent a home in Freeport?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Freeport 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,495 | $850 | $3,000 |
Freeport 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,549 | $1,200 | $2,150 |
Freeport 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,035 | $1,600 | $2,800 |
Freeport 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,258 | $2,350 | $5,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Freeport
What type of rentals are currently available in Freeport?
There are currently 51 Apartments for Rent in Freeport, TX with pricing that ranges from $500 to $2,000. There are also 39 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Freeport ranging from $550 to $5,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Freeport?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Freeport ranges from $550 to $5,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,681.
